Digital Utilities are foundational digital services provided by the Government, which enable our citizens and businesses to transact seamlessly in a trusted and secure way in the digital economy. These include: digital ID, payments, data exchange, document attestation.
As part of the Sectoral Transformation Group in IMDA, the Digital Identity and Document Attestation Division is looking for a Manager/ Senior Manager to drive adoption and utilisation of existing Digital Utilities, such as digital identity and document attestation, and develop new Digital Utilities, such as Verifiable Credentials, that can give Singapore enterprises a competitive advantage to capture value for Singapore in the digital economy.
